Question 1 (Q1):

Newer theories in child development and parenting have emerged to provide a more comprehensive understanding of the complexities involved in the growth and upbringing of children. These theories address various aspects of child development, including sociocultural influences, moral development, and intersectionality. One theory that particularly resonates with me and seems to meet a significant need in understanding child development is the Intersectionality theory.

Intersectionality, developed by Kimberlé Crenshaw, emphasizes the interconnectedness of various social identities and how they intersect to shape an individual’s experiences and opportunities. This theory is essential because it recognizes that a person’s development is not solely influenced by a single factor but rather by multiple dimensions of their identity, such as race, gender, class, and more.

In my opinion, Intersectionality makes the most sense because it acknowledges the complexity of individual experiences and helps us understand how different aspects of identity can lead to unique challenges and opportunities for children and parents. For example, a child growing up in a marginalized community may face intersecting challenges related to race, socioeconomic status, and access to quality education.

To relate this theory to a personal experience, I have a close friend who grew up as a biracial individual in a predominantly white neighborhood. Their experiences and challenges were profoundly influenced by their intersectional identity. They often had to navigate issues related to racial identity, discrimination, and cultural integration, which had a significant impact on their development and parenting approach when they became parents themselves.

In summary, newer theories like Intersectionality provide a more holistic perspective on child development by considering the multifaceted nature of individual identities and their impact on parenting and upbringing.
